我是flow3的新手。实际上,我已经下载了flow3软件包并将其放在本地Ubuntu机器的服务器目录中。但它要求我提供对 flow3 目录的权限。语法是
$ sudo ./flow3 flow3:core:setfilepermissions johndoe wwwuser wwwgroup
哪个johndoe
是用户名,wwuser
是 Web 服务器的用户名,哪个wwwgroup
是 Web 服务器的组。
不幸的是,我不知道如何知道我的Web服务器用户名和Web服务器组是什么。
请参阅此链接以了解更多信息。
谢谢大家对我的问题进行审查。在互联网上艰难搜索并询问我的朋友后,我可以使用以下命令:
$ sudo ./flow3 flow3:core:setfilepermissions vannkorn www-data www-data
然后它要求我加入 Web 服务器的组。所以我使用了这个命令:
$ sudo usermod -a -G www-data vannkorn
之后,我需要在我的 flow3 目录上提供权限 777:
$ sudo chmod 777 -R /home/vannkorn/dev/flow3/
之后,最重要的事情是在我的虚拟主机中添加文档根目录。
<VirtualHost *:80>
DocumentRoot /home/vannkorn/dev/flow3/web/
ServerName flow3_learning
<Directory />
Options FollowSymLinks
AllowOverride All
Order allow,deny
allow from all
</Directory>
</VirtualHost>
无论如何,感谢您的家伙查看这篇文章,我希望这对其他人有所帮助。